Bangladesh Wins Toss, Fields Against England in One-Day Cricket Decider
By - Jul 12, 2010
Bangladesh won the toss and put England in to bat in today’s final one-day cricket international at Edgbaston.
The series is tied 1-1 after Bangladesh won by five runs two days ago, its first win over England.
England left out James Anderson and the injured Ian Bell, and included Tim Bresnan and Ravi Bopara. The Bangladesh lineup is unchanged.
Play is due to open shortly after rain delayed the start
